hard-nosed
hard-nosed (härd′nōzd′)adj. Hardheaded.hard-nosed adj informal tough, shrewd, and practical hard-nosed (ˈhɑrdˌnoʊzd) adj. Informal. hardheaded or tough; unsentimentally practical: a hard-nosed leader.
